**First-Day Checklist — Item 7: Data-Centre Cage Visit**

Team assistants should book the new starter's orientation walk-through of the Halloway Park data hall with the Quenfield Operations desk at least one day ahead. Confirm the starter has completed the short safety briefing video and has closed-toe footwear. Escort them to the loading-bay entrance, not the main reception — cage tours start from there. Photography is prohibited inside the hall. At the inner cage gate, the escorting assistant should enter the access code shown below.

badge for hahif-faweg: bdg-VF-9

## Changelog — Skimmer load-test defaults changed

As of release 4.2, Skimmer's default load profile for the Pellwright checkout flow has changed. Ramp-up is now gradual rather than stepped, and the default virtual-user ceiling was raised to match real peak traffic observed last quarter. Old saved scenarios still work but emit a deprecation warning. The new default configuration applied to fresh runs is listed below.

deployment values, kajep-kageg:
[praix]
host = praix.paliqcorp.corp
user = praix_svc
database = praix_prod

### Encoding detection — review checklist

When reviewing changes to the Lanterbeck upload pipeline, verify that the detector samples the first 64 KB only, falls back to UTF-8 on ambiguous input, and records the confidence score in detect_log. Files flagged below 0.6 confidence must route to manual review, never silent transcoding. Confirm the detect_log writes go through the pooled writer, which authenticates with the connection string below.

primary connection of tajeg-tajop = postgresql://julax_svc:DI@db-e7f3.kelvidyn.corp:5432/rusdor

Heads up for support: the Stockmend reconciliation job that matches warehouse counts against the Tindle storefront now runs in parallel shards instead of one giant pass. Practical upshot: the job finishes around 02:30 instead of 06:00, so morning discrepancy reports should be ready when your shift starts. If a customer reports stale counts mid-run, that's expected — shards commit independently. We sized the shard count and batch limits conservatively for this quarter's volume; the current settings are listed below.

tuning table, yajog-yahof:
BUDGETS = {
    "lamvan": 303,
    "wenox": 460,
    "fenvan": 525,
}